Additional Government Pleader (Tax) C O M M O N O R D E R By consent, the main Writ Petitions are taken up for disposal at the admission stage itself.
2.The petitioner has filed the above Writ Petitions to issue Writs of certiorarified mandamus to call for the impugned proceedings of the respondent dated 16.02.2018 for the assessment years 2010-11, 2011-12, 2012-13, 2013-14 & 2014-15 and to quash the same and further direct the respondent to re-do the assessment in accordance with law after providing personal hearing to the petitioner.

3.The learned counsel appearing for the petitioner submitted that the respondent had passed the impugned orders without affording an opportunity of personal hearing to the petitioner, which is violative of principles of natural justice. 4.Mr.M.Hariharan, learned Additional Government Pleader (Tax) taking notice for the respondent submitted that since the petitioner was not given an opportunity of personal hearing, the impugned orders may be set aside and the matter may be remitted back to the respondent for fresh consideration. 5.Having regard to the submissions made by the learned counsel on either side, taking into consideration that the petitioner was not given an opportunity of personal hearing, which is violative of principles of natural justice, the impugned orders are liable to be set aside on this ground alone.
Accordingly, the impugned orders dated 16.02.2018 are set aside and the matter is remitted back to the respondent for fresh consideration. The respondent is directed to decide the matter afresh, on merits and in accordance with law, after giving due opportunity of personal hearing to the petitioner. 6.With these observations, the Writ Petitions are allowed. No costs. Consequently, connected miscellaneous petitions are closed.
